Hmmm.. you got me... the wires are: black = ground, pink = ignition, pink w/black stripe = ignition off of the ECM fuse (typically powers sensors and solenoids and such)

May not go to anything, might just be the factory's test connector, where they hooked up to the harness to check out that and ECM at the component mfg plant before assembling it into a car...

Check your INJ1 & INJ2 fuses, and ECM fuse.

That connector will plug into your dash harness. Take a close look around, the mating connector is going to be close by. On the early harnesses, they used that grey connector in addition to the C207 connector on the right of the picture. Notice that just about all if not all the cavities on the C207 connector are full, hence the need for the second connector.
